I have a passion for classical and classical crossover music which makes me suitable for both traditional and modern … Web11 nov. 2012 · Former Delfonics singer Major Harris died on Friday (Nov. 9) in Richmond. He was 65 years old. The R&B, soul singer left the Delfonics in 1974 to go solo and record his hit 1975 song "Love Won't Let Me Wait." Before making a name for himself with the Delfonics in the early '70s, Harris was a member of several groups including The …
